The Book of Ruth (abbreviated Rth) (Hebrew: מגילת רות , Megilath Ruth, "the Scroll of Ruth", one of the Five Megillot) is included in the third division, or the Writings (), of the Hebrew Bible; in most Christian canons it is treated as a history book and placed between Judges and 1 Samuel.. Key to understanding the narrative is the concept of the kinsman-redeemer, the closest living male relative who had the duty to preserve the family name and land. All of these duties could be refused, including marriage to the late relative’s widow (now known as “levirate” marriage, levir being the Latin translation of the Hebrew word for brother-in-law). In certain cases, one could be a goel (Hebrew for “close relative” or “redeemer”) without being a levir (one who would provide an heir to the deceased relative through marrying his widow).
